What is a Roustabout?

A roustabout is an entry-level position on an oil rig, responsible for maintaining the rig's equipment and facilities. This includes tasks like painting, cleaning, and repairing machinery. Roustabouts work in teams and are typically supervised by a deck crew leader or a rig manager.

Offshore Vacancies for Roustabouts

Offshore oil rigs are located all over the world, but the majority of them are in the Gulf of Mexico, the North Sea, and off the coast of Brazil. Roustabout jobs are typically offered by drilling contractors, who work with major oil companies to extract oil and gas from the ocean floor. Some of the most popular contractors include Transocean, Noble Drilling, and Ensco.

Qualifications for Roustabout Jobs Offshore

While a degree in engineering or a related field can be helpful, it's not always necessary to become a roustabout offshore. Most employers prefer candidates who have some experience in a manual labor job, such as construction or farming. You should also be physically fit and able to work long hours in challenging conditions.

Skills Needed for Roustabout Jobs Offshore

In addition to physical fitness, there are several skills needed to succeed as a roustabout offshore. These include the ability to work in a team, good communication skills, and the ability to follow instructions. You should also be comfortable working at heights and in confined spaces.

Benefits of Working as a Roustabout Offshore

One of the biggest benefits of working as a roustabout offshore is the high pay.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ual salary for roustabouts is $39,400. In addition to high pay, roustabouts often receive free room and board while working on the rig, as well as free transportation to and from the rig.
